Dr. Novick offers a gripping narration of his unconventional path, starting with his early interests in NASA before a pivot to medicine led him to become a world-class pediatric heart surgeon. His dedication to sharing knowledge-starting with his missions to Colombia-and his bravery in practicing in war-torn regions where few others dared to go, is nothing short of heroic.

Beyond his surgical skills in helping children with congenital heart defects in distressed, war-torn countries, training local doctors in other countries to handle these patients, the book is a masterclass in the 'healer's touch, ' reminding us how the sages of medicine intended us to interact with the sick. I was also deeply moved by his tribute to his wife, whose support while raising their children made his global mission possible. This is a must-read for any aspiring physician or healthcare professional seeking to rediscover the true heart of service

Novick, one of the world's foremost pediatric cardiac surgeons, has dedicated his life not to the polished halls of elite medicine but to the forgotten corners of the globe. His mission: to save the "blue babies"-infants with complex congenital heart defects-in countries where political instability, poverty, and conflict have extinguished all hope.
